Introduction: The Evolving Landscape of Bitcoin Investment

The journey of Bitcoin from a niche, decentralized digital asset to a recognized component of mainstream financial portfolios has been marked by several pivotal moments. Perhaps none is more significant in recent history than the introduction and subsequent success of regulated Bitcoin Exchange-Traded Funds (ETFs). These financial vehicles have bridged the gap between traditional finance (TradFi) and the volatile cryptocurrency ecosystem, offering regulated, accessible exposure to Bitcoin without the complexities of self-custody.

For seasoned crypto traders familiar with the intricacies of perpetual swaps and options, the impact of these large institutional capital flows—channeled through ETFs—on the underlying futures market is a critical area of study. The Bitcoin futures market, particularly CME Group’s contracts, serves as the primary barometer for institutional sentiment and price discovery. Understanding the interplay between ETF inflows and futures market dynamics is no longer optional; it is essential for anyone seeking to trade crypto derivatives professionally.

This comprehensive guide will dissect how ETF flows influence liquidity, volatility, basis levels, and the overall structure of the Bitcoin futures market, providing actionable insights for the modern crypto trader.

Section 1: Understanding the Vehicles – ETFs vs. Futures

Before examining the impact, it is crucial to clearly delineate the two primary instruments involved: Spot Bitcoin ETFs and Bitcoin Futures Contracts.

1.1. Spot Bitcoin ETFs: The On-Ramp for Institutional Capital

Spot Bitcoin ETFs, such as those tracking the spot price of Bitcoin directly, function as traditional securities traded on established exchanges. They are designed to appeal to institutional investors, wealth managers, and retail investors who prefer the regulatory clarity and ease of access provided by regulated brokerage accounts.

Conclusion: The New Equilibrium

The introduction of Bitcoin ETFs has irrevocably changed the dynamics of the Bitcoin futures market. It has layered a powerful, regulated institutional demand mechanism onto an ecosystem previously driven primarily by retail sentiment and crypto-native speculation.

For the derivatives trader, this means the futures market is now more mature, generally deeper, and more closely tethered to the fundamental valuation drivers perceived by TradFi. While volatility remains inherent to Bitcoin, the directionality and persistence of trends are now heavily influenced by the daily capital flows channeled through these exchange-traded products. Success in this new era requires synthesizing traditional derivatives analysis—understanding margin trading requirements, technical charting (as covered in guides on technical analysis for futures trading)—with real-time monitoring of institutional capital movement. The futures market is no longer just a speculative playground; it is the essential hedging and price discovery mechanism for the world’s largest digital asset class.
